WebJul 25, 2024 · When you can’t fully extend the knee, we doctors call that an “extension lag”. We also usually measure that in degrees. So 10 degrees of extension lag means that the knee is bent 10 degrees in flexion and won’t extend any further. WebNov 1, 2024 · In true locked knee, the knee is physically incapable of moving.
